What I Look For in a Detox Week Purchase
When I plan a detox week, I focus on products that feel simple, supportive, and easy to stick with. I want items that help me stay hydrated, eat clean, rest well, and avoid anything too complicated. For me, the best choices are the ones that fit naturally into my routine without adding stress.
My Must-Have Basics
I usually start with a few essentials that make the week smoother:
- Water bottle or hydration jug: I need something that reminds me to drink enough water throughout the day.
- Herbal teas: I like calming teas that help me relax and replace sugary drinks.
- Fresh produce or detox-friendly groceries: I look for fruits, vegetables, greens, and simple whole foods.
- Meal prep containers: These help me stay organized and avoid unhealthy last-minute choices.
- Journal or planner: I use this to track how I feel, what I eat, and how much water I drink.
What I Check Before Buying
Before I buy anything for my detox week, I always check a few things:
- Ingredients: I avoid products with too much sugar, artificial additives, or unnecessary fillers.
- Ease of use: I prefer items that are simple and convenient because I want the week to feel manageable.
- Quality: I look for fresh, reliable, and trusted options that feel worth the money.
- My personal goals: I choose products based on whether I want more energy, better digestion, or a reset from heavy eating.
